Burgos (RGS) to Warsaw (WAW)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Burgos Airport (RGS) in Burgos, Spain to Warsaw Chopin Airport (WAW) in Warsaw, Poland is 2,137 kilometers (1,328 miles / 1,154 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 4h, flying northeast at a heading of 51°.

This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.

This is an international route connecting Spain with Poland.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 06:11 in Burgos, it's 06:11 in Warsaw.

There is a significant elevation difference of 2,583 feet between the two airports. Warsaw Chopin Airport sits lower than Burgos Airport.

The return flight from Warsaw (WAW) to Burgos (RGS) follows a heading of 249° (west southwest).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
